    About the Book

    Edit


    Top government statistician and probability theorist, Martin Bruce is either a
    genius or . . . insane. His therapist and a theoretical physicist are enabling
    an experiment to determine which, but can Martin and the universe survive
    it?

    Martin Bruce is a brilliant systems analyst at defense contractor, Martin
    Marietta. But he believes that he has stumbled upon another dimension by
    accidentally playing their resonant frequencies on his array of musical
    synthesizers and sequencers. This has caused him to insist that he is
    suffering from what he refers to as a “time lag,” making it impossible for him
    to leave his house. His employer has referred him to psychotherapist Dr.
    Karen Albers, whose battery of tests has uncovered repressed memories of
    abuse in his childhood and the possibility of adult-onset schizophrenia. His
    time lag has instilled in him agoraphobia so their sessions are all conducted
    online where Dr. Albers has difficulty trying to separate his brilliance from
    his psychosis. Their conversations blend science, philosophy and
    psychotherapy which amuse Martin Bruce and fascinate Karen Albers.
    Dr. Albers soon learns that her patient has also been conferring with MIT
    theoretical physicist, Dr. Jason Paramus, and she asks Martin’s permission
    to speak to him to see if any of his personal observations and scientific
    queries have any merit. After speaking with him, she is astonished to find
    that his theories and self-diagnosis of a time-lag, as a result of “visiting” an
    alternate dimension cannot be dismissed. The three of them agree to
    conduct an experiment which could change the very foundations of
    science, philosophy and life as we know it.

    About the Creator
    wallahhy
    Barry R Norman
    Gloucester, MA

    Barry Norman has been a media junkie, having worked in the magazine, newspaper, radio, television and film industries. In the music biz, he was the creator/writer/producer of the nationally syndicated, alternative radio show, Cross Currents (currently in pre-production for an independent doc), and in the promotion department for Savage Records which released David Bowie’s album, Black Tie White Noise. In film, he was the Founder and Executive Director for the Dahlonega and Rome (GA) International Film Festivals His film Deadbeats stars a young Melissa McBride (Carol from The Walking Dead) and Mick Foley (Cactus Jack, Dude Love and Mankind from professional wrestling) and has been illegally pirated and downloaded all over the world. AMBIENT SANITY is his fifth book. His previous books include his autobiography trilogy, Flipping Point, The Angriest Childhood in the World and The Delightful Denver Doldrums.
